We all know how dirty smoking can be. That's why
Inspector Vapor cleaned it up, eliminating the smoke
from the process and 95% of the carcinogens that
might otherwise enter your lungs.
It's a pure clean inhalation that kind of works
like a medicinal vapor rub – but don't rub anything
on you, necessarily. Instead, you pack the little
bowl with your substance of choice, throw
some ice into the pipe, then with the Variable Temperature
Heat Gun Vaporizer, you heat the substance, the
vapor is pushed up into the pipe, cooled by the
ice, and into your mouth. Yum!
The advantages to Inspector
Vapor's Got Vape? Vaporizer Kit extend beyond
its ease of use. It's better for you than conventional
smoking methods. Let's break this down with a little
chemistry lesson. When you put a flame to a smokable
substance – whatever it may be – the leafy stuff
turns to smoke, releasing nasty carbon and carcinogens
into the air, and consequently your lungs. The juices
inside the substance that you really, really, want
are stuck inside the bog of smoke.
Supposedly, the whole technique was developed by
the ancient Scythians (plains people of southwestern
Asia) when they threw a form of cannabis on red
hot stones in a closed room to create a vaporizing
sensation. The Greeks copied it and now you can
too!
